Rotating crop families to prevent soil depletion and pests
Rotating crop families is a smart and effective way to keep your garden healthy and productive. Different crop families have unique nutrient requirements and can attract specific pests and diseases. By changing the crop family each season, you reduce the risk of soil depletion and pest build-up.
For example, legumes like beans and peas fix nitrogen in the soil, while heavy feeders such as zucchini and tomatoes might deplete nutrients. Rotating these crops prevents overuse of any one nutrient, keeping soil fertility balanced. It also confuses pests and diseases that target specific plant families, reducing infestations.
This practice promotes a natural cycle, encouraging beneficial soil microbes and minimizing the need for chemical interventions. When planning crop rotation, it’s helpful to keep track of which families you’ve planted, so you can vary them through different seasons for optimal soil health and pest control.
Incorporating cover crops for soil health during off-season
Incorporating cover crops for soil health during off-season is a smart strategy to improve your garden’s soil naturally. These plants, like clover, vetch, or rye, are grown not for harvest but to enrich the soil and prepare it for future crops.
Cover crops add organic matter to the soil, boosting fertility and encouraging beneficial microorganisms. They also help prevent soil erosion and reduce weed growth when space is limited, making them ideal for small gardens.
By planting cover crops during the off-season, you keep the soil active and healthy year-round. Their roots break up compacted soil, enhancing aeration and water retention, which supports the next crop planning.
Overall, using cover crops during the off-season can lead to healthier soil, better crop yields, and easier maintenance, fitting perfectly into a planned crop rotation to suit seasonal changes.

Preventing soil erosion in different weather conditions
To prevent soil erosion in different weather conditions, it’s important to adapt your crop rotation and planting techniques accordingly. Weather changes, like heavy rain or strong winds, can wash or blow away soil if not managed properly, especially in small gardens.
Using cover crops during seasons with high erosion risk is highly effective. Cover crops such as clover or vetch protect the soil surface by holding it in place with their roots. Additionally, they add organic matter, improving soil structure and fertility.
Implementing mulching around plants also helps reduce erosion. Organic mulches, like straw or shredded leaves, slow water runoff and prevent soil from being displaced during storms or heavy rains. Consider using contour planting or creating small terraces on sloped areas to further minimize runoff.
Other practical steps include maintaining a diverse crop rotation plan that includes deep-rooted plants. Their roots bind the soil and stabilize it against seasonal weather impacts. Regularly monitoring weather forecasts allows you to prepare and adjust your practices quickly, ensuring your soil stays healthy and secure.

Inspiring Examples of Successful Seasonal Crop Rotation Practices
Successful seasonal crop rotation practices often inspire gardeners to adapt their methods to their unique climates and garden sizes. For example, a small backyard in a temperate region might rotate lettuce and spinach in early spring, followed by tomatoes and peppers in summer, then cover crops like clover in fall to restore nutrients. This approach helps maximize space and maintain soil health throughout the year.
Another inspiring example is urban container gardening, where gardeners switch from root vegetables like carrots in cooler months to leafy greens and herbs as temperatures rise. They carefully plan their planting schedule to rotate crops that differ in nutrient needs, preventing soil depletion and pest buildup. This method illustrates how seasonally adapted crop rotation can be effectively implemented even in limited spaces.
Some small-scale farms boost soil fertility naturally through crop rotation by alternating legumes such as beans or peas with nitrogen-demanding crops like corn. This natural nitrogen fixation improves soil conditions without chemical fertilizers.
